Most Pet Friendly Sanctuary On Spruce Creek Apartments for Rent

The apartment community in the Sanctuary On Spruce Creek area of Daytona Beach, FL that ranks the highest in Pet Friendliness Lifestyle Score on ApartmentHomeLiving.com is Ocean Oaks with prices starting from $1,185 and a Pet Friendly score of 3.4 of 4. Springs At Port Orange scores the second highest with a 3.2 of 4 and has availability currently starting from $1,444. Here are the most Pet Friendly Sanctuary On Spruce Creek apartments for rent in Daytona Beach, FL:

Apartment ListingPet RatingNeighborhoodPriced From
Ocean Oaks3.4/4Port Orange Gateway Center$1,185
Springs At Port Orange3.2/4Outer Port Orange$1,444
Sanctuary at West Port3.2/4Craig Farms$1,372
